Middlemarch

George Eliot

In a Midlands town, Dorothea’s ardor and Lydgate’s ambition meet the web of other people’s money and marriages. Vocation is tested by the everyday.

Provincial novel

Characters

Dorothea Brooke

A Saint Theresa born too late for a convent, hungry for a large life.

Tertius Lydgate

Doctor whose scientific future is mortgaged to a drawing room.

Edward Casaubon

A scholar whose Key to all Mythologies is a tomb.

Themes

Vocation

What a life is for, when history offers no monastery and no simple reform.

The social web

No plot is private; gossip and debt are forms of fate.

Motifs

Unvisited tombs

The famous close: hidden lives that hold the world together.
